TRAVERSE CITY — Toby’s Dog House has opened a new location inside Silver Spruce Brewing on East Eighth Street in Traverse City. The restaurant, owned by Toby Smith, specializes in Michigan-made hot dogs and a variety of street-style sandwiches.
The business originally began as a food truck converted from a camper trailer in Manistee. Toby later opened a restaurant in Munising before expanding to Traverse City to provide the area with specialized hot dog options.
The expansion to Traverse City occurred after the owners of Silver Spruce Brewing reached out to Toby about a potential partnership. “The Silver Spruce actually contacted me about maybe coming down here and doing my thing,” Toby said. “And so here we are.” Toby, who is originally from Florida, previously operated a camper-trailer food truck in Manistee and a restaurant in Munising.
The menu features a variety of hot dogs with names inspired by dog breeds and locations. Options include the Porky Pug, the New Yorkie, the Windy City Wiener and the Poppin’ Poodle. Toby noted that he typically selects the ingredients for a new item before deciding on a catchy name.
One specific menu item, the Roaring Lion, was designed to honor the Detroit Lions. It features bacon, grilled onions and blue cheese. “That’s actually my favorite hot dog on the menu,” Toby said. “If you like blue cheese you’re over the moon with that one.” A similar version called the Mike’s Buddy is available with cheddar cheese instead of blue cheese.
Toby emphasized that the quality of the meat and bread is the most important factor for his sandwiches. He chose to use Michigan-made Koegel hot dogs based on a recommendation from his grandmother, who lived in Flint. “She’d always tell me, Koegel hot dogs are the best,” Toby said. “It’s all in the ingredients you use... You use fresh buns... it’s all about the meat and the bread.”
Beyond hot dogs, the restaurant serves Cuban sandwiches, authentic heroes and various tacos, including a Korean street taco and a chicken bacon ranch version. The menu also includes sides such as chicken tenders and red onion rings. Toby mentioned that his background in Florida influenced the inclusion of the Cuban sandwiches.

Toby plans to incorporate more seafood and New Orleans-style po’boys into the menu once the weather becomes warmer in Traverse City.
